Ticket: PICK-2281 — Intermittent connection failures in PathWeaver optimizer

Since Tuesday's deploy, the pick-list optimizer at the Larkmoor warehouse drops its pool connections roughly every 40 minutes, forcing full route recomputes. Retries succeed but add ~9s latency per wave. We suspect the pooler's idle timeout conflicts with the new keepalive setting. To reproduce, connect to the staging optimizer database with the string below.

replica DSN, yahog-kawig: redis://istox_svc:um@db-8a67.halixforge.test:5432/frawyn

The garage occupancy feed for the Brindlewood campus arrives over a message queue every thirty seconds, one record per level, published by the Stallgrid edge boxes. Counts can briefly go negative when a sensor double-fires on exit; the ingest job clamps these to zero and flags the interval. If the feed stalls for more than five minutes, the dashboard falls back to the last known snapshot. Sensor mappings, queue names, and the replay procedure are documented on the internal page below.

runbook for tahog-kadug: https://gitlab.qirvanworks.corp/projects/pages/view/b139298aed28

The Verifrax plugin registry exposes a REST endpoint for registering custom data validators. Each plugin must declare its schema version and a validation entrypoint before activation. Requests to the registry are authenticated with an internal service key passed in the request header; without it, registration is rejected. For development, use the key that follows.

API key for tagef-fafop: vxb2-ta

The Pebblestat sidecar scrapes app metrics and ships rollups to the Harrowfen aggregator every 10s. Most knobs have sane defaults: FLUSH_INTERVAL, BATCH_MAX, and TAG_ALLOWLIST rarely need touching. If rollups stop arriving, check the sidecar logs before blaming the aggregator — it's usually a stale credential. That credential lives in the sidecar's env file, and it goes on the line immediately after this sentence.

vault entry, kagep-yajeg: COURIER_KEY5=da097